1st stop of the tour: Bernina Pass

On December 28th and 29th 2007, the first race of this year's Swiss Snowkite Tour took place on the Bernina Pass. The Lago Bianco and its beautiful surroundings are an El Dorado for all snowkiters. Unfortunately, in the radiant sunlight, the wind ditched us and the first day of racing was called off early.



On Sunday, the wind was back, so that 3 runs á 15 minutes could be started. In the end, I came in 7th, which was then corrected to 8th place, due to an error. Oh well, not bad for the first race of the season. I'm sure the next race will bring an improvement.



The 2nd stop of the Snowkite Tour 2008 was Lake Dauben, located at 7218ft/2200m at the Gemmi Pass in the Swiss canton Wallis. Just transporting all the participants equipment to the high alpine location was an organizational and logistical challenge, which was mastered brilliantly by all of the aides. On Saturday, the first 3 runs started during strong snow flurries and good wind.



Exciting one-on-one competitions with bad visibility in the deep snow, demanded a lot from the riders. A sociable evening in the mountain hotel ended the day. Sunday morning brought bright sunshine and wind. The day could only turn out awesome. The riders showed up to the briefing at the lake early. 3 runs were started again. However, the wind got weaker and the race ended prematurely. It went well for me though and I finished in 6th. That put me in 6th place in the overall ranking too.
